ISO is the International Organization for Standardization. It is an independent, non-governmental organization that develops and publishes international standards for a wide range of industries, including technology, food safety, agriculture, healthcare and others.

In order to be certified with an ISO standard, your organization must implement a management system that meets the requirements of the relevant standard and be audited by an accredited certification body. If the audit is successful, your organization will be awarded a certificate of conformity.
